WebJan 20, 2014 · Anthropologists and archaeologists can, in fact, tell the difference between adult male and female skulls — sometimes. But the skeletons of baby boys and baby girls just don't look that different.

WebFeb 12, 2024 · Moms carrying baby girls exhibited a more inflammatory response (more cytokines), while moms carrying boys didn't experience as much inflammation when their immune system was … WebMar 24, 2024 · It’s popularly believed that in the womb, boys have a heart rate of 120-140 beats per minute, and girls have a heart rate of 140-160 beats per minute. In reality, a fetus’ heart rate ranges anywhere from 120-160 beats per minute and changes depending on …
